What To Know About Your Dealership’s Preferred Auto Body Shop

Auto body shops that repair your vehicle the right way It might seem challenging to figure out which car repair facility performs quality work, and which ones don’t, but it’s actually very simple. The shop that follows the manufacturer’s protocol and whose repairmen have the right … Read More